Overview

Nothing kills a potential book sale faster than sending a US reader to Amazon UK, or vice versa. Geniuslink solves this headache by creating smart universal links that automatically route readers to their local bookstore or the right regional version of Amazon, Apple Books, or other retailers. Instead of managing dozens of different store links for each book, authors get one clean link that works everywhere. It's particularly valuable for self-published authors and indie publishers who sell across multiple countries and platforms.

How Geniuslink Works

You start by adding your book details and the various store links where it's available — Amazon US, UK, Canada, Apple Books, and so on. Geniuslink creates one master link that you can use everywhere. When someone clicks it, the system detects their location and device, then automatically sends them to the most appropriate store. Think of it like a smart traffic controller for book sales — it knows where each reader should go and gets them there instantly. You can also set up custom rules, like prioritizing certain retailers or handling specific regions differently.

Geniuslink Pricing

Geniuslink starts at $6 per month and doesn't offer a free plan, which can feel steep if you're just getting started with self-publishing. However, if you're actively selling books internationally, the increased conversion rates often justify the cost quickly. The pricing is straightforward without hidden fees, and the entry-level plan covers the core features most authors need. It's worth checking if they offer any trial periods, as the investment makes more sense once you see how much easier international book marketing becomes.

Geniuslink FAQ

Q: Do I need separate accounts for different pen names or series?

No, you can manage multiple books and author names under one account, though you'll want to check the limits on your specific plan.

Q: What happens if someone clicks my link from a country where my book isn't available?

You can set up fallback destinations, like sending them to your website or a universal retailer that ships internationally.

Q: Can I use these links in Amazon ads or other platforms with strict linking policies?

Generally yes, but always check the specific ad platform's terms of service, as some have restrictions on redirect links.

Q: Will using Geniuslink affect my search engine rankings or social media reach?

No, the links use proper redirects that don't hurt SEO, and social platforms treat them normally since they're clean, professional URLs.

Q: How quickly do link updates take effect when I change where they point?

Usually within a few minutes, though some users report occasional delays during high-traffic periods or major updates.
